Replaced battery 2 weeks ago as original battery went dead overnight. Just now, that new battery went dead. We just drove it yesterday. Any thoughts? 2022 Outback Limited XT.
 
Last edited:
Check that there are no lights like a dome light or something left on. Other than that, have it checked out as in the alternator is working etc.
It doesn't take a lot to drain a battery overnight.
Have them check the current draw with the car not running. This is done by connecting a milliampmeter between the battery and a disconnected battery cable. This is called parasitic drain and it should be very small as in a few milliamps at most. If it's more get them to find out why.
 
What he said. And check the charging voltage at idle and rpm. Should be ~14.3-14.8 ish.
